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/google-maps/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google maps 在谷歌静态地图中显示路径_Google Maps - Fatal编程技术网

Google maps 在谷歌静态地图中显示路径

Google maps 在谷歌静态地图中显示路径,google-maps,Google Maps,我可以在谷歌静态地图中显示一条由点组成的路径。 我可以在谷歌静态地图中显示一条路径,该路径由多段线的enc组成。 但是,在大多数情况下,我无法显示同时具有点和enc的路径。 虽然我在普通的谷歌地图上看到了路径。 有时,它确实起作用,正如您在以下内容中所看到的: 但在大多数情况下,它只显示一个或另一个。 我的应用程序(旅行和事件)使用户能够添加一个两者结合的路径。因此,作为实施基准的问题中的示例在图像标记中有这么长的URL“{i@lFqPpGmSn@乌比丘_Am@o@g@k@i@sA}@艾比娅}A

我可以在谷歌静态地图中显示一条由点组成的路径。 我可以在谷歌静态地图中显示一条路径,该路径由多段线的enc组成。 但是,在大多数情况下,我无法显示同时具有点和enc的路径。 虽然我在普通的谷歌地图上看到了路径。 有时,它确实起作用,正如您在以下内容中所看到的: 但在大多数情况下,它只显示一个或另一个。
我的应用程序(旅行和事件)使用户能够添加一个两者结合的路径。

因此,作为实施基准的问题中的示例在图像标记中有这么长的URL“{i@lFqPpGmSn@乌比丘_Am@o@g@k@i@sA}@艾比娅}AyA{AuAu@y@{@s@oEmDuJsH{HqGoFcFkCwBaAq@sEwD_@c@{@gAkBoCk@k@y@i@无环族{@@WSMMGMIe@Us@]m@E]EMIw@
C{ByAwByAt@eC@QJ_@FIJCJBz@vAv@
A
A|@d@Z
@JRNbBdA\RPHtBvA^VPX^^pAhA|A
AlAv@t@n@xAnBrAjB~@~@hhfglhbjr~N&path=color:0x0000ff | weight:3 | enc:ivuwFrxmbMxC|BlDhCv@t@bFfFfA~@jAx@fCxAdE
CxBz@tA
@tATnJlAtATrA^jAh@bG|DjAt@h@Tf@PvAPbA@rAOvOkCnEu@l@QZO\O|@s@tAaBnA_Bf@g@ZSd@]h@Wp@Sh@If@Ct@AzBJtDXf@Hr@N|Aj@zDlBtK~FbAd@fA^dARlAJrCPtKp@
D\lCl@dAXtAl@|F | B~JfEnChAv@b@~@v@t@~@TZl@pAj@HBZLBL@@r@P|G?ZLpEPbG@n@\vEj@hM
BnTFpAx@vLp@~If@vGNzAVdBj@lBpAfC~@jBtAtD
G | LjA|Bc@h@&路径=颜色:0x0000ff |重量:3 | enc:gkmwFp|tbMb@i@哈克斯^v@xA
C~DhHb@r@pBvDxAxCz@nBn@tB^xAjAjIJlAEHwCl@[HFXD
CGh@o@五@@^q@Zo@硬件设备_@c@GW?UCEVMp@WhBIx@Cl@BrAFhAHvAEh@CTQn@_@l@i@b@c@R[Fs@@YCw@Sg@S_EcCcC_B{@dCqD}B[Q_A}@(7.0155469)40.10 10.55469;40.10 10.15 15 9 9;40.10 10.15 55469 9;40.10.714141414141414141414141414141414141414141414141418946、74.10 10.0160618841414141414141418946,,,,,,,,,,,,,,,,,,,40404040404040404040407878787878787878616161616141414141414141414141414141414141414141414141414141414141414141414141414141414141414141418946;46;46;40.4141414141414141414141414141414141414141414141418946;46;46;46;40.4141414141414141414140404040404040404040404097779 | 40.6998918576991,-74.02623282071533 | 40.69009790752417,-74.032176595589234 | 40.68944709570568,-74.04419289227905 | 40.6892494,-74.0445004&key=AIzaSyBZ2ijM7ygGfp|BPNY2ClcoSexWta8rXXQ&language=en“

这里的点是标记由“&”操作符分隔,路径参数非常直接,lat/lng坐标由“|”分隔运算符。对于enc参数,您可以访问此项以查找编码的多段线。创建多段线并获取编码值。最后合并与示例中相同的参数,您将获得所需的静态地图图像


希望这有帮助!!

谢谢你的回复。请注意,在我的问题中,我写道,它在某些情况下运行良好,但在其他情况下不起作用。当它不起作用时,它有时只显示enc,有时只显示lat/lng路径。但这怎么可能呢?我的意思是,一旦加载静态图像,它就应该显示所有组件,它是ma删除类似标记、多段线等。问题可能与基础平台有关。